The 21-team league will be held in Las Vegas, on the campus of UNLV, from July 11-20 at both the Thomas & Mack Center and COX Pavilion. Two of Detroit’s games - vs. L.A. Lakers (July 11) and vs. Dallas (7/17) - will be televised by NBA TV. In addition to game action, NBA TV will provide reports on summer league teams, featuring interviews with players, coaches and team executives. NBA.com will provide live webcasts of all games. Games featuring L.A. Lakers, L.A. Clippers, Milwaukee, Dallas and Charlotte will be open to the media and general public.
